Day 1 — Kick-off & Escape Room 🕘
- 09:00 — 10:00: Kick-off by the CISO/ISO. He gives an introduction to the importance of cybersecurity and explains the week and the prizes to be won.
- 10:30 — 12:00: Cybersecurity Escape Room — Teams work together to solve cyber risks in a challenging escape room game!
- 12:00 — 13:00: Lunch break and opportunity for a short recap.
Day 2 — Phishing & Ethical Hacking 🎣
- 09:00 — 10:30: Phishing training & quiz — Employees learn how to recognize and prevent phishing emails, followed by an interactive quiz.
- 11:00 — 12:30: Ethical Hacking demo — An ethical hacker shows how hackers work and what you can do to protect yourself against them.
- 12:30 — 13:00: Lunch break and end of the morning.
Day 3 — Cybersecurity @home 🏡
- 12:30 — 13:30: Cybersecurity @home training & quiz — Over a catered lunch, an interactive session will take place about how employees can work safely from home and protect valuable company data.
Day 4 — Simulation & Incident Management 🔏
- 12:30 — 13:30: Plenary internal workshop — During a catered lunch, employees get the opportunity to ask questions about privacy and data security.
Day 5 — Closing & drinks 🥂
- 12:30 — 13:30: Speaker — An interesting speaker stops by to tell more about the consequences of the lack of security awareness.
- 15:00 — 17:00 Closing drinks & awards ceremony — We will end the week with a nice drink and announce which team has won the most points.
Time spent
During the Cybersecurity week employees participate in cybersecurity activities on a daily basis (8-16 hours in total), while having enough space to work on their own work.
